Cracked Wheat Pilaf with Pickled Red Onions
Ingredients
4 Tbsp unsalted butter
1⁄2 medium onion, peeled and finely diced
1 medium carrot, peeled and finely diced
2 stalks celery, finely diced
2 cloves garlic, finely minced
2 tsp thyme, finely chopped
3 cups aromatic vegetable stock or water
1 cup bulgur wheat
1 cup pickled red onions (recipe online)
Salt, to taste
Directions
1. In a medium saucepan, heat the butter until it begins to bubble. Add the onion, carrot, and celery. Cook for 4 minutes, stirring occasionally, until translucent.
2. Add the garlic and cook for 5 minutes, stirring. Add the thyme, and season lightly with salt. Add the stock and season again with salt.
3. Bring the mixture to a boil. Add the wheat. Stir and lower the heat to simmer. Cover the pan and cook for 15 to 18 minutes, until wheat is tender. Season with salt, if necessary.
4. Top with pickled red onions.
